在PHP中,ImagickKernel::scale方法用于缩放Imagick内核
▥php
𝄐 0
php ImageMagick,php Imagick,php Imagick pdf太大转失败,php ImageMagick 卡通算法,php Imagick 竖线,php Imagick gradient
在PHP中,ImagickKernel::scale方法用于缩放Imagick内核。Imagick内核是一种数学核心,用于图像处理和滤波操作。
scale方法可以根据提供的比例因子将Imagick内核的大小进行缩放。比例因子大于1时,内核将变大;而比例因子小于1时,内核将变小。
以下是一个示例,说明了ImagickKernel::scale方法的用法:
php
$kernel = ImagickKernel::fromMatrix([
[-1, -1, -1],
[-1, 8, -1],
[-1, -1, -1]
]);
$kernel->scale(2); // 缩放内核的大小为原来的2倍
echo $kernel->toString();
在上面的示例中,首先创建了一个3x3的Imagick内核。然后使用scale方法将内核的大小缩放为原来的2倍。最后,输出缩放后的内核。
请注意,ImagickKernel::scale方法会直接修改原始内核对象,并不会返回新的内核对象。
希望以上解释对您有所帮助!
在PHP中,ImagickKernel::scale方法用于缩放Imagick内核。Imagick内核是一种数学核心,用于图像处理和滤波操作。
scale方法可以根据提供的比例因子将Imagick内核的大小进行缩放。比例因子大于1时,内核将变大;而比例因子小于1时,内核将变小。
以下是一个示例,说明了ImagickKernel::scale方法的用法:
php
$kernel = ImagickKernel::fromMatrix([
[-1, -1, -1],
[-1, 8, -1],
[-1, -1, -1]
]);
$kernel->scale(2); // 缩放内核的大小为原来的2倍
echo $kernel->toString();
在上面的示例中,首先创建了一个3x3的Imagick内核。然后使用scale方法将内核的大小缩放为原来的2倍。最后,输出缩放后的内核。
请注意,ImagickKernel::scale方法会直接修改原始内核对象,并不会返回新的内核对象。
希望以上解释对您有所帮助!
本文地址:
/show-283275.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。